An MSDCNN-LSTM framework for video frame deletion forensics
摘要
Frame deletion detection is a challenging task in the field of digital video forensics. This paper proposes a deep-learning-based frame deletion detection method for single-shot videos. We capture traces of frame deletion forgery from both adjacent and long-range continuous frames. Specifically, we propose a novel multi-scale difference convolutional neural network (MSDCNN) structure, which models different levels of inter-frame variations. Then, we use the long-short-term memory network (LSTM) to capture the long-term variation pattern of multi-scale differential features. The proposed method is a simple and principled frame deletion detection framework with a small computational cost. According to the experiments, the proposed framework can achieve a more advanced performance of frame deletion detection than traditional methods and methods based on 3D convolutions.
